W210 ac need help asap!!!
Ok so I haven't done anything to the car and just had gauges hooked up and was told there was plenty of freon in the system. Ac won't turn on unless I hold down both auto buttons, and when I let go the compressor shuts back off. Ex button led works like it should if I push it led comes on if I push it again led goes off. The CCU is known to take a dump. I took mine apart and there was extensive corrosion on the foil traces. I had to solder jumpers over the bad parts to get it working again.
